Creating positive and negative space drawing with scissors: Students learn a lot about composition and color by working with positive and negative space – the shape created by the leftover paper when you cut out a shape. Students can try this for themselves using three different colored sheets of paper. Students cut one large shape using a continuous cut. Then they glue that shape to one sheet and the negative shape created with the leftover paper each on a separate sheet of paper.
